What companies run services between Milan, Italy and Harzgerode, Germany?

You can take a train from Milano Centrale to Harzgerode via Arth-Goldau, Basel SBB, Kassel-Wilhelmshoehe, Nordhausen, and Nordhausen Nord in around 15h 15m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Milano, Autostazione Lampugnano to Harzgerode, Augustenstr. via Göttingen central bus station, Göttingen Bahnhof/ZOB, Leinefelde, Sangerhausen, and Sangerhausen, Busbahnhof in around 20h 31m.
